MENTAL HEALTH ACT 2000 - SECT 288AA

288AA Certificate of forensic disability service availability

(1) This section applies for the purpose of the Mental Health Court deciding whether a forensic order (Mental Health Court—Disability) is to state that the person to whom the order relates is to be detained in the forensic disability service for care.

(2) If asked by the director (forensic disability), the chief executive (forensic disability) must give the director (forensic disability) a certificate stating whether or not the forensic disability service has the capacity for the person's detention and care.

(3) The director (forensic disability) may give the certificate to the court.

(4) The court may ask the director (forensic disability) to give the court a certificate of the chief executive (forensic disability) stating whether or not the forensic disability service has the capacity for the person's detention and care.

(5) If the court makes a request under subsection (4), the director (forensic disability) must give the certificate to the court within—

(a) 7 days after receiving the request; or
(b) any longer period allowed by the court.
